Two Suspects Arrested for Attempted Carjacking in Gaithersburg

For Immediate Release: Monday, January 7, 2019

Detectives from the Major Crimes Division have charged Jemmy Antonio Chica-Cornejo, age 21, of South Frederick Avenue in Gaithersburg, and a 14-year-old male juvenile of Gaithersburg, with an attempted carjacking that occurred in the area of South Frederick Avenue (Route 355) and West Deer Park Road on January 3.

On January 3 at approximately 6:50 p.m., 6th District officers and Gaithersburg Police Department officers were dispatched to the intersection of South Frederick Avenue and West Deer Park Road for the report of two males who were acting disorderly and one of them having a gun.

A Montgomery County police officer responding to the call observed the two suspects in the roadway of the 500 block of South Frederick Avenue.  One of the suspects was standing directly in front of a stopped truck and the other suspect was also standing near the vehicle.  Both suspects ran from the area but were apprehended after officers pursed them on foot and set up a perimeter.  A Gaithersburg police officer located a BB gun in close proximity to where the teenager was arrested.

The victim of the attempted carjacking stated that Chica-Cornejo was banging on the driver's side window of his vehicle and was pulling on the door handle and yelling while the juvenile stood directly in front of his vehicle.

Officers spoke with several witnesses in the area who stated that the two suspects were repeatedly walking in and out of the roadway and forcing vehicles to stop. One of the witnesses said he saw the juvenile suspect remove a gun from his waistband, point it at a vehicle, and then put the gun back in his waistband.

During police interviews, both suspects made admissions of guilt.  Chica-Cornejo and the juvenile suspect were charged with attempted carjacking and first-degree assault.  Chica-Cornejo was transported to the Central Processing Unit and the juvenile suspect was detained by the Department of Juvenile Services.
